Rationale of Assessment
This assessment format is important for two reasons. Primarily, this assessment tool can be used to guage where a student is as far as there
capabilities in this format. Secondary to this is that many of the topics covered in this class are based on using the same concepts on different
data sets. Given this, it is important to practice these skills repetitively so that they are able to replicate said skills using any number of data sets
(ie, practice makes perfect). Specifically, these worksheets will be based on formula use and will range in content based on the lesson of the day.
Worksheets will often be partially completed in class as a group, then students will have time in class to finish the worksheet. Any additional
work should be done at home and the worksheet will be expected to be complete by the next day, when it will be collected. Again, practice
makes perfect, and worksheets provide that practice.

Formative Informal
There are countless ways to assess students through informal means. There will a variety used in my class, which can be found here
(http://www.bostonpublicschools.org/cms/lib07/MA01906464/Centricity/Domain/44/Formative_Informal.pdf). I intend to use from this list
assessments that are individual and in groups. For individual, I will use: 3-2-1, exit tickets, muddiest point, and one minute paper. For group, I
will use: Class check, class vote, and learning cell. Most of these are focused on literary skills but can easily be modified into mathematical or
chemistry concepts. The use of other techniques seen in this list are not necessarily going to be excluded, but will be used only as it happens to
come up. The overall goal of these assessments is in order to guage where students are in order to tailor remaining class time to cover areas of
weakness in understanding
